BMW DTC P0DA4 – Drive Motor ‘B’ Inverter Voltage Sensor ‘A’ Circuit Range/Performance

DTC P0DA4 meaning on BMW

The DTC P0DA4 code on a BMW indicates an issue with the Drive Motor ‘B’ Inverter Voltage Sensor ‘A’ circuit. This means that the powertrain control module (PCM) has detected a range or performance problem with the voltage sensor in the inverter for the drive motor ‘B’.

BMW DTC P0DA4 symptoms

Symptoms of the BMW DTC P0DA4 code may include reduced power output, poor acceleration, and in some cases, the vehicle may go into a limp mode where it operates at reduced performance levels to prevent further damage.

BMW DTC P0DA4 causes

The causes of the DTC P0DA4 on a BMW can vary, but common reasons include a faulty drive motor inverter, damaged wiring or connectors in the voltage sensor circuit, or issues with the voltage sensor itself.

BMW DTC P0DA4 seriousness

The DTC P0DA4 code should be addressed promptly to prevent further damage to the drive motor system. Ignoring this issue can lead to more severe problems and potentially costly repairs.

How to diagnose DTC P0DA4 on BMW

To diagnose the DTC P0DA4 on a BMW, a mechanic would typically use a diagnostic scanner to retrieve the fault codes and then perform a thorough inspection of the drive motor ‘B’ inverter voltage sensor ‘A’ circuit. This may involve checking the wiring, connectors, and the sensor itself for any signs of damage or malfunction.

How to fix DTC P0DA4 on BMW

Fixing the DTC P0DA4 on a BMW may involve replacing the drive motor inverter, repairing or replacing damaged wiring or connectors, or replacing the faulty voltage sensor. It is recommended to follow the manufacturer’s repair procedures and use genuine parts to ensure proper functionality.

How to erase DTC P0DA4 on BMW

Once the underlying issue causing the DTC P0DA4 on a BMW has been fixed, the fault codes can be cleared using a diagnostic scanner. This will reset the PCM and turn off the check engine light. It is important to verify that the issue has been resolved before clearing the codes.
